Colonel showcases new furniture collection at Maison & Objet 2013
Published: 28-Jan-2013
French label Colonel showcased its furniture collection inspired by camping at the 2013 edition of Maison & Objet design fair in Paris, France.
The entire furniture collection was divided into First and Second. Colonel's First collection is inspired by outdoor furniture. The collection mixes colours, rhythms and patterns, and is mainly composed of wood, textile materials and colours.
The collection evokes summer and relaxation. It includes Faces, a standing lamp with a diagonal fabric shade that tilts like an umbrella; and Caracas, new version of a '60s living-in tent chair that is available in yellow, pink or blue colours.
The Second collection of Colonel includes the Dowood light, Diabolo light, and Pondy table.
The Dowood lamp has a metal groundwork and a beech shadow painted with bright geometric forms. It is available as both ceiling light or a small or large table light. Dowood lamp is also available in seven colour sets.
The Diabolo light is available as a tripod, table or ceiling lamp and comprises of a steel border clothed with a gradient-printed fabric shadow in mint, azure and pink, or yellow and pink.
Inspired by camp furnishings, the beech Pondy table has turquoise cross rails and comes with a bench with yellow cross rails. It exhibits a raw and minimal look, where wood and metal interlock to create a harmonious whole.
